Bloody Shiraz Gin, gin combined with Shiraz grapes? Bloody brilliant. This crazy experiment using their original Rare Dry Gin steeped with local cool climate Shiraz grapes has become a cult-favourite, the perfect balance of sweet fruit and ginny goodness.

Craigellachie 23 Years with extended maturation, showing ripe fruit, honey, citrus and beeswax, refined and open with a long, soft and lightly drying finish.
A rare single malt marrying Irish smoothness with Japanese elegance. Matured for 7 years in bourbon barrels, then finished in exotic Mizunara oak for notes of sandalwood, vanilla, spice, and orchard fruits. Bottled at 46% ABV, non-chill filtered
Aged in Bourbon Barrels before being finished for 6 months in Oloroso Sherry Hogsheads sourced from producer Miguel Martin in Jerez. Richer and fuller than the Kilmory edition with notes of sweeter spices and fruit.
